The KOSIN Barbecue Grill Light is an excellent choice for anyone who loves to grill after dark. It features 9 high-density LEDs that provide a super bright, wide light beam, ensuring you can see your cooking area clearly at any time. The light sports a powerful magnetic base, making it easy to mount on any magnetic surface without needing special tools. Additionally, the 360-degree flexible gooseneck allows you to direct the light exactly where it's needed, offering great adjustability.

If your grill is not made from a magnetic material, you may need to find an alternative mounting solution. This light is constructed from durable aluminum alloy, ensuring it's weather-resistant and can withstand extreme conditions, including rain and snow. Therefore, it is suitable for year-round use.

The included 6 AAA batteries save you the hassle and the initial cost of buying batteries, and being battery-powered means you can use it anywhere, even beyond grill lighting, such as for camping or mechanics work. On the downside, relying on AAA batteries means you might need to replace them frequently if you use the light extensively. With a user-friendly design and a versatile, portable nature, this barbecue grill light is ideal for outdoor enthusiasts and anyone needing a reliable, bright light source.

The LED Concepts BBQ Grill Light is designed to provide bright and efficient illumination for outdoor grilling and various other tasks. One of its standout features is its 360-degree adjustable gooseneck, which allows you to direct the light exactly where you need it, making it highly versatile for different uses, such as camping or reading.

The light is powered by 12 LEDs, which are energy-efficient and long-lasting, although it requires 3 AAA batteries that are not included in the package. The product's magnetic base and adjustable screw clamp offer flexible mounting options, enabling attachment to most metal surfaces or various other surfaces securely. This makes it suitable for different types of grills, including Weber, Traeger, and Pit Boss.

Constructed from weather-resistant aluminum, it is durable and can withstand outdoor conditions, enhancing its reliability for outdoor use. However, it’s important to note that the batteries needed to power the light are not provided, which might be a minor inconvenience. This grill light is a versatile and robust choice for grilling enthusiasts who need reliable lighting in various conditions.

Buying Guide for the Best Led Barbecue Grill Light

Choosing the right LED barbecue grill light can significantly enhance your grilling experience, especially during evening or night-time cooking sessions. The right light will ensure you can see your food clearly, cook it to perfection, and enjoy a safe grilling environment. Here are some key specifications to consider when selecting an LED barbecue grill light, along with explanations to help you make the best choice for your needs.
BrightnessBrightness is measured in lumens and indicates how much light the LED grill light emits. This is important because it determines how well you can see your grilling surface. Lower brightness (up to 100 lumens) is suitable for small grills or if you only need a bit of extra light. Medium brightness (100-200 lumens) is good for average-sized grills and provides a balance of visibility without being too harsh. High brightness (200+ lumens) is ideal for large grills or if you need very clear visibility. Choose the brightness level based on the size of your grill and how much light you need to see your cooking area clearly.
Mounting OptionsMounting options refer to how the light attaches to your grill. This is important for ensuring the light stays in place and illuminates the right area. Common mounting options include magnetic bases, clamp mounts, and screw mounts. Magnetic bases are easy to attach and remove but require a metal surface. Clamp mounts are versatile and can attach to various parts of the grill, while screw mounts provide a more permanent solution. Consider how you want to position the light and the type of grill you have to choose the best mounting option for your needs.
AdjustabilityAdjustability refers to the ability to change the direction and angle of the light. This is important for directing the light exactly where you need it. Some lights offer flexible necks or swivel heads that allow you to adjust the beam. Fixed lights are less versatile but may be sufficient if you only need light in one specific area. If you often cook different types of food or use various parts of the grill, an adjustable light will provide more flexibility and better coverage.
Battery LifeBattery life indicates how long the light will operate before needing a recharge or new batteries. This is important for ensuring your light lasts through your grilling sessions. Short battery life (up to 5 hours) may be sufficient for occasional use. Medium battery life (5-10 hours) is good for regular grilling, while long battery life (10+ hours) is ideal for frequent or extended use. Consider how often and how long you grill to choose a light with an appropriate battery life.
Weather ResistanceWeather resistance refers to the light's ability to withstand outdoor conditions such as rain, heat, and cold. This is important for durability and ensuring the light functions properly in various weather conditions. Look for lights with an IP rating, which indicates their level of protection against dust and water. An IPX4 rating means the light is splash-resistant, while an IPX7 rating means it can withstand being submerged in water. Choose a light with a weather resistance level that matches your typical grilling environment.
Color TemperatureColor temperature is measured in Kelvin (K) and indicates the color of the light. This is important for visibility and how the light affects the appearance of your food. Lower color temperatures (2700K-3000K) produce a warm, yellowish light that is easy on the eyes but may not show true food colors. Medium color temperatures (3500K-4500K) offer a neutral white light that balances warmth and clarity. Higher color temperatures (5000K-6500K) produce a cool, bluish light that provides the most accurate color representation. Choose a color temperature based on your preference for light color and how accurately you want to see your food.
